Edgar Wright has a blind spot for Monica Lewinsky

 
Familiar face: Monica Lewinsky (Picture: David M. Benett/Getty)
30 July 2014

As one of the country’s most popular film directors, one would think that Edgar Wright would have got used to famous people by now, but it seems he has a little way to go. The man behind Shaun of the Dead and Hot Fuzz took to Twitter yesterday after struggling to place a face. “You know when you smile at someone you think you recognise because they look familiar,” he tweeted, “and then realise it’s Monica Lewinsky?”

Don’t feel too embarrassed Edgar — you’re not the only one. We recently bumped into Lewinsky mere moments after she had been confused for one of the Kardashians.
